Prices in Kellyville are holding strong, in fact on a month on month basis over the last 12 months, prices are slightly increasing.

​KELLYVILLE MEDIAN PROPERTY PRICE (ANNUALLY)

Kellyville has 117 properties available for rent and 170 properties for sale. Median property prices over the last year range from $1,180,000 for houses to $790,000 for units. If you are looking for an investment property, consider houses in Kellyville rent out for $650 PW with an annual rental yield of 2.9% and units rent for $495 PW with a rental yield of 3.3%. Based on five years of sales, Kellyville has seen a compound growth rate of 4.9% for houses and 2.6% for units.
